Thank Heaven

Because media productions are also subject to financial constraints, music budgets are often hit first.

In this way, it is not always possible for media producers to clear the rights of a master recording besides that of the composition itself (the actual song) for their use in an audio/visual project such a commercial (sorry for the legalese!!).

This is the reason why we often hear our favourite tunes on TV but with slightly different renditions: those songs are re-recorded by different performers for the economical sake! [more...]

From an artistic point of view, supervising music for movies and TV series is probably one of the most interesting tasks that a music supervisor can deal with. Indeed, a story is told…
A narrative can be so significant that it gives the music a powerful and dramatic role as to how the story is felt by the viewers. When they can’t get involved in the drama in any other way, it means there is definitely magic happening in the film. [more...]
